I have win ME with a problem. Whenever I play MIDI's, the synthesizer volume is set very loud so I go to the volume control panel and turn down the synthesizer volume. The volume goes down. When I play another MIDI, the synthesizer volume is set where I first found it. The synthesizer volume won't stay where I put it. What can I do?
